Output 345ca126561ae89abc4cd3a193f5a3eb21ff70c78f43f7320a1e529e1d606790:0

value
2010186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c647e03d77c97e7977a27ef65e637cb0be9ac8 OP_EQUAL
address
3Do4eeuts89TjYf6FKiuKzpcKdoMHjGqdb
transaction
345ca126561ae89abc4cd3a193f5a3eb21ff70c78f43f7320a1e529e1d606790
spent
true